Calculating cost of sales formula is relatively straightforward. That is once you understand what to include and exclude from the equation. WebDefinition of cost of sales. Cost of sales (also known as "cost of goods sold") refers to the cost required to manufacture or purchase a product that is then sold to a customer. Essentially, the cost of sales refers to what the seller has to pay in order to create the product and get it into the hands of a paying customer.

[...] million in the second quarter of 2012 and in … cinemagraph wineWebIf margin is 30%, then 30% of the total of sales is the profit. If markup is 30%, the percentage of daily sales that are profit will not be the same percentage. Some retailers use markups because it is easier to calculate a sales price from a cost.
